StuComm welcomed onto Jisc Step Up programme

With growing interest from educational institutions in the United Kingdom, StuComm wanted to ensure that UK decision-makers were confident their requirements could be met. To do so, StuComm decided to apply for the Jisc Step Up programme. We are happy to announce that we have now been welcomed onto the Step Up programme and look forward to working with educational institutions in the UK to help their students succeed on campus.

When they heard about the trouble institutional decision-makers were having when looking to work with EdTech startups, Jisc looked to solve their problems. By assessing startups, it provides decision-makers with an easy to understand overview of startups which meet certain requirements and can be rolled out at UK institutions. To universities Jisc says:

“The robust and vetted Step Up companies that we believe will help you solve those challenge areas are always available for you to engage with here.”

StuComm and the Step Up programme

July 2020 marks the month StuComm joins the Step Up programme. Jisc is satisfied with the recent assessment, as Eva Stirling, Engagement Leader at Jisc notes:

“We are delighted to welcome StuComm who have just become Jisc-assessed, onto the Step Up programme.”

With support from Jisc, StuComm will be engaging with education leaders to help them in their communication challenges, by utilising the StuCommApp. The app provides universities with the ability to provide their students with the right information, at the right time, via the right channel. Student success through optimal communication

Luke Billings, UK Manager at StuComm, is excited with the admission to the Step Up programme. “So far, we have helped over 30 institutions in The Netherlands with more than 700,000 students using our StuCommApp. We are looking forward to helping support even more institutions and students in the UK as well. Currently, we are working with the University of Reading to help both them and their students. With the support of Jisc we will be better placed to help even more universities.”

“At StuComm, we work tirelessly to help students succeed on campus. We believe the key to success is for students to be informed, engaged and inspired. By communicating the right message, at the right time, via the right channel, we are able to help students succeed” Luke notes. Jisc has created an overview of StuComm’s proposition on their site.
